Baseball Team Ranked Fifth in Final National Poll
The UW-Stevens
Point baseball team finished the season one spot higher than it started the
year in the NCAA Division III rankings.
Ranked sixth in
the American Baseball Coaches Association preseason poll, the Pointers ended
up fifth in the final poll of the year on the strength of their amazing
postseason run that included 10 straight wins when facing elimination and a
win at the Division III World Series.
UW-Stevens
Point dropped out of the rankings after a 4-5 record in March. The Pointers
were ranked 30th entering the NCAA tournament and moved back into the top 10
after earning their World Series berth. They ended the year with a 35-18
overall record, including a 6-5 record against other ranked teams with two
one-run losses to second-ranked Wheaton (Mass.) and a 2-1 setback to
top-ranked Marietta (Ohio) at the World Series. |
